Macrovision Acquires Installshield
July 2, 2004
CHICAGO - InstallShield Software Corporation, the leading provider of software-installation tools, has announced that on July 1, 2004 the company completed its sale to Macrovision Corporation for $76 million in cash.
An additional payment of up to $20 million is contingent upon post-acquisition performance.
"We are very pleased with this deal as it will take the company to the next step in the evolution mapped out by its founders," says Matthew S. Brown, a chair of the Technology Practice at Katten Muchin Zavis Rosenman in Chicago and lead counsel to InstallShield for the deal. He is available to discuss the deal.
